What companies run services between Luton, England and Exeter, England?

You can take a train from Luton to Exeter St Davids via Farringdon, Farringdon Without, and London Paddington in around 3h 29m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Luton Station Interchange to Bampfylde Street via Heathrow Central Bus Station in around 5h 50m.
